Photo-Illustration: by The Cut; Photos: Getty Images Paris Hilton has spoken: ‘Recycling is hot.” This declaration was apparently inspired by her acquisition of a large-scale portrait of her own face made entirely of cans, which she posted on Instagram:
Hilton is far from the only celebrity to share her commitment to sustainability and making it hot. For example, in a Vogue interview earlier this week, Olivia Wilde — the “chief brand activist” of skin-care company True Botanicals — affirmed that “sustainability is sexy.
Meanwhile, Coldplay has announced that they will be embarking on a “sustainable and low-carbon” tour next year. This endeavor will involve planting one tree for every ticket they sell, using vegetable oil in all the tour vehicles, and using solar panels for their gear. Most notably, their concerts will feature a kinetic dance floor that will gather energy from the crowds and somehow funnel it back into the show’s power source.
Though I appreciate the effort, realistically, attempting to make an impact on our rapidly deteriorating climate is, unfortunately, not very sexy, mostly because sustainability is often a lie and the things that do make a difference — mainly, consuming less — are, while necessary, not actually very glamorous.
